
Indiana hits Road for Illinois, Northwestern
4/7/2016 1:50:00 PM | Women's Tennis
BLOOMINGTON, Ind. – The Indiana women's tennis team will hit the road this weekend to take on Illinois and Northwestern. The Hoosiers battle the Fighting Illini on Friday, April 8 at 5 p.m. ET in Champaign before moving on to Evanston to battle the Wildcats on Sunday, April 10 at 12 p.m.
These two matches will be the final two road Big Ten matches for Indiana (13-6, 3-2) on the year before the Hoosiers play their final four of the season in Bloomington. IU sits at No. 68 in this week's national team rankings after falling to Purdue last weekend.
For the first time in 2016, an IU player is ranked nationally in singles play as Paula Gutierrez has climbed to No. 90 overall in the country. The junior has played well during conference matches and was recently named Big Ten Women's Tennis Athlete of the Week on March 29.
Illinois (10-6, 4-1) has been hot as of late, winning five matches in a row and six of its last seven, including four of those on the road. The Fighting Illini are ranked No. 50 in this week's ITA National Team Rankings as their doubles duo of Ines Vias and Louise Kwong sit at No. 43 in the country in doubles.
Northwestern (7-8, 5-0) has yet to lose in Big Ten play in 2016. The No. 38 Wildcats have a pair of players ranked in the national singles rankings in No. 54 Maddie Lipp and No. 91 Erin Larner. In doubles, Lipp teams with Alex Chatt to rank 25th in the country as Larner and Alicia Barnett are the No. 47 doubles pair in the nation.
